Third quarter runs helps Mont Alto defeat New Kensington 68-53

Penn State Mont Alto 68, Penn State New Kensington 53

 

MONT ALTO, Pa.- Kaleigh Hartman scored a team-high 25 points as Mont Alto had strong second and third quarters on their way to defeating Penn State New Kensington 68-53 in PSUAC action Thursday. Dariana Perez also had 20 points and 12 assists in the winning effort.

 

New Kensington built an early 8-0 lead in the first quarter as Mont Alto went 0-8 from the field until Kaleigh Hartman took the lid off the basket to get Mont Alto on the board with 4:38 remaining in the first quarter. Down 11-6, Mont Alto went on a 5-0 run to tie the game at 11-11 after one quarter.

 

Esther Cole made a layup as New Kensington led 17-13 and Mont Alto scored back-to-back baskets to tie the game at 17-17 with 6:59 left in the half. Dariana Perez made two free throws at the end of the first half as Mont Alto went into the locker room with a 31-25 advantage.

 

Hartman and Perez came out of the half and each made a three pointer to push the Mont Alto lead to 37-25. The lead would balloon to 15 points near the end of the quarter as Mont Alto led 51-37 after three quarters.

 

Two successful free throws by Autumn Fischer and a basket by Hartman ballooned the lead to 61-40. New Kensington couldn't get within 13 the remainder of the quarter as Mont Alto defeated New Kensington by a final of 68-53.

 

New Kensington Leaders

Esther Cole 17 points, 20 rebounds

Destiny Batiste 16 points

 

Mont Alto Leaders

Kaleigh Hartman 25 points, 12 rebounds

Dariana Perez 20 points, 12 assists
